Glycogen, a branched polysaccharide of glucose, is the principal storage form of energy in animals and humans. This reagent-grade product is widely used in biochemical and pharmaceutical research as a standard for glycogen assays, in studies of carbohydrate metabolism, and as a component in cell culture media. It is stored in the liver and muscles, where it can be rapidly broken down into glucose to meet energy demands during physical activity or fasting. In the liver, it maintains blood glucose levels for vital organs like the brain. In muscles, it fuels contraction and movement. Glycogen is also explored in sports science for performance enhancement via carbohydrate loading and in medical research on disorders such as diabetes and glycogen storage diseases. As a specialty chemical, it serves as a niche additive in formulations for drug delivery and tissue engineering.
format_list_bulleted Product Specification
| Test Parameter | Specification |
|---|---|
| Assay (Total Sugars) | 90-100 |
| Loss on Drying | <=0.5% |
| Reducing Sugars | 0-1 |
| Specific Rotation (α20D, c=0.1 H2O) | 160-180 |
| Appearance | White to light beige crystalline powder |
| Solubility 20 | 50 g/L (H2O) |
